Goenka: Setting the dominoes rolling
"I've written against supersession all my life. How can I put up with my own supersession now?" With these words, Kuldip Nayar, 56, the burly newshound, veteran of many scoops, and editor of Express News Service, the news network of theIndian Expresschain, bowed out of office last fortnight.
